Abstract:
A carrier dechucking system includes a work carrier including a substrate having a first surface, an opposite second surface with a support film attached, and a ring frame surrounding the substrate. The work carrier is placed on a placement table having a support surface on which a lower surface of the support film is maintained, lifting pins configured to move the work carrier, an ionizer configured to eject ions to the lower surface, and a controller. The controller is configured to control the lifting pins to move the work carrier from the support surface to first and second levels, and to control the ionizer to remove static electricity charged on the support film from the support surface to the first level. At the first level, a surface voltage of the first surface of the substrate is lower than a surface voltage of the lower surface of the support film.
Abstract:
An apparatus for chucking a wafer, the apparatus including a vacuum chuck arranged under the wafer with a ring frame to fix the wafer using vacuum, a plurality of clampers directly making contact with the ring frame to downwardly compress the ring frame in a vertical direction, and a plurality of alignment blocks pushing the ring frame toward a central portion of the wafer in a horizontal direction to align the wafer.
Abstract:
A substrate debonding apparatus configured to separate a support substrate attached to a first surface of a device substrate by an adhesive layer, the substrate debonding apparatus including a substrate chuck configured to support a second surface of the device substrate, the second surface being opposite to the first surface of the device substrate; a light irradiator configured to irradiate light to an inside of the adhesive layer; and a mask between the substrate chuck and the light irradiator, the mask including an opening through which an upper portion of the support substrate is exposed, and a first cooling passage or a second cooling passage, the first cooling passage being configured to provide a path in which a coolant is flowable, the second cooling passage being configured to provide a path in which air is flowable and to provide part of the air to a central portion of the opening.
Abstract:
A bonding apparatus of substrate manufacturing equipment includes an upper stage, a lower stage facing the upper stage and which is configure and dedicated to support a processed substrate on which semiconductor chips are stacked (set), and an elevating mechanism for raising the lower stage relative to the upper stage to provide pressure for pressing the substrate and chips towards each other.
